PAKISTAN DEMANDS COMPENSATION AT COP27 FOR CLIMATE-FUELED FLOODING
At the COP27 summit last week, Pakistani leadership, representing the G77 umbrella group of developing countries, called on developed countries to increase their financial support for helping developing countries recover from and adapt to climate disasters (AP News). While Pakistan is only responsible for 0.4% of the world’s historic emissions, it has borne the brunt of the impacts of climate change, ranking as the eighth most climate-stressed country.
